Gujarat to Rajasthan: A look at how India celebrated Makar Sankranti this year
New Delhi, January 14: India celebrated Makar Sankranti with great joy and enthusiasm, as the festival marks the Sun's transition into Capricorn (Makara). Known by different names across the country, including Uttarayan, Pongal, Maghi, and Dahi Chura, the festival features unique traditions in each region. From kite flying to taking holy dips, people celebrated the festival in their own unique ways on Tuesday. Hence, let's take a look at how states across the country are celebrating the Sankranti festival.
Sweet shops in Gujarat experience huge rush on Makar Sankranti
Gandhinagar, Jan 14: Makar Sankranti, also known as Uttarayan in Gujarat, is one of the most awaited festivals of the year, marking the beginning of longer days as the Sun embarks on its northward journey. In 2025, the festivities on January 14 brought communities together in joyous celebration, filling the skies with colourful kites and the streets with the delicious aroma of Undhiyu and Jalebi.

Gujarat CM visits Bodakdev Wildlife Care Center as part of Karuna Abhiyan initiative
Ahmedabad, January 13: Gujarat Chief Minister Bhupendra Patel visited the Wildlife Care Centre in Bodakdev, Ahmedabad, as part of the state-wide Karuna Abhiyan initiative to rescue and treat birds injured by kite strings during the Uttarayan festival from 10 to 20 January 2024.
